blob: d31f301ba3dc9593e1e99135912ab333ff5a2cd6 [file] [log] [blame]
Evan Cheng24753312011-06-24 01:44:41 +00001//===-- X86TargetDesc.h - X86 Target Descriptions ---------------*- C++ -*-===//
2//
3// The LLVM Compiler Infrastructure
4//
5// This file is distributed under the University of Illinois Open Source
6// License. See LICENSE.TXT for details.
7//
8//===----------------------------------------------------------------------===//
9//
10// This file provides X86 specific target descriptions.
11//
12//===----------------------------------------------------------------------===//
13
Evan Chenge862d592011-06-24 20:42:09 +000014namespace llvm {
15class Target;
16
17extern Target TheX86_32Target, TheX86_64Target;
18} // End llvm namespace
19
Evan Cheng24753312011-06-24 01:44:41 +000020// Defines symbolic names for X86 registers. This defines a mapping from
21// register name to register number.
22//
23#include "X86GenRegisterNames.inc"